High Pressure Cylinders
BAC is an approved and registered pressure vessel manufacturer with the U.S. Department of Transportation (D.O.T.). Our Registration Number is M5324.
Our vast knowledge of a variety of composite materials allows us
to design and fabricate pressure vessels with aluminum liners and a variety of composite
material overwraps (in an epoxy resin) including:
·
fiberglass
·
aramid
·
carbon
In addition, we offer high pressure designs using thermoplastic liner materials and other
super alloys. |
|
This D.O.T. compliant high pressure cylinder has an aluminum core and is wound with
Kevlar® and fiberglass. It is well suited for applications such as breathing air for
firemen, as well as nitrous oxide, hydrogen, natural gas and compressed air.

Medical Oxygen Cylinders

BAC Sets the Standard in Composite Cylinder Design! Just Ask Our Competition!
- The LIGHTEST Weight Cylinder Available!
Up to 60% lighter than lightweight steel or aluminum and 25% lighter than glass
fiber wrapped cylinders.
- The FIRST Composite Cylinder to receive 5-year RETEST per U.S. D.O.T. (Aug. 2000)!
- Impact resistant, high strength Kevlar® fiber
Cutting Edge but Proven Technology! Same material that is used in armored military vehicles, fireman's
breathing air cylinders, & bullet-proof vests.
- UV resistant, maintenance free, scuff coat
No repainting required.
|

|
- 12 cu. ft. of Oxygen
- Weighs ONLY 2.0 lbs. at 0 psig
- Diameter: 4.33" (Same as Alum. "D")
- Height: 11.20" (w/o valve)
- Service Pressure: 2650 psig
- Min. Burst Pressure: 9275 psig
